2. Luxe Fabrications: Elevating the Tracksuit Game

Modern tracksuits are all about luxury. The use of premium fabrications like velour, silk, and cashmere elevates these ensembles to a new level of sophistication. This shift has resulted in tracksuits being worn not only for casual outings but also for semi-formal events.

4. Retro Revival: Nostalgia with a Twist

Fashion often revisits the past for inspiration, and tracksuits are no exception. Retro designs from the ’80s and ’90s, characterized by vibrant color blocking and oversized logos, are making a comeback. This nostalgic twist adds an element of fun and uniqueness to tracksuit fashion.
